The ingredients needed to make Fruits salad with mint leave sugar syrup:
  1. Get 1 cup Watermelon
  2. Get 1 cup Banana
  3. Take Oranges 2 medium size
  4. Prepare 1 cup Pineapple
  5. Make ready Sugar to ur taste
  6. Make ready Water 1 and half cup
  7. Get 10 pieces Mint leave

Instructions to make Fruits salad with mint leave sugar syrup:
  1. In a bowl cut your watermelon,banana,pineapple in to chunks. Remove the cover of orange slice and divide it.
  2. In a small pot heat some water mint leave and sugar till the sugar melt
  3. Then sieve in your mix fruits
  4. Add some ice cubes ro put in a fridge
